How often should I bring my light-duty diesel vehicle in for maintenance?
Maintenance intervals depend on the make and model of your vehicle, but our experts generally recommend oil changes every 10,000 to 15,000 miles, fuel filter replacement every 10,000 to 15,000 miles, air filter replacement every 20,000 to 30,000 miles, transmission fluid changes every 30,000 to 60,000 miles, and coolant system flushes every 30,000 miles. What are the signs that my diesel truck needs repair?
Watch for these warning signs that your light-duty diesel vehicle may need attention: engine misfires or rough idling, loss of power or acceleration issues, excessive exhaust smoke (especially black or white smoke), poor fuel economy, engine warning lights (Check Engine light, DPF warning), increased engine noise, and overheating or coolant issues. What is a Diesel Particulate Filter (DPF), and why does it need cleaning?
The DPF is an important part of the exhaust system that traps soot and particulates from the exhaust gases. Over time, it can become clogged, causing reduced engine performance, poor fuel economy, and even engine damage.
